Peter Milliken wrote:

> I am in infrequent user of texinfo mode
[...]
> I was trying to add a node using C-c C-c n and after typing C-c C-c I
> was presented with a prompt on the command line of:
>
> Command: (default TeX)
>
> Since all the other bindings use the same C-c C-c sequence, they all
> appear to be broken.


This indicates you are using the AUCTeX package. This defines its own
Texinfo mode, with different keybindings to the standard mode. AUCTeX
is not part of Emacs. Consult the AUCTeX documentation for the AUCTeX
keybindings. Or stop loading AUCTeX in your .emacs or site-start file.


> C-c C-c runs the command TeX-command-master

An AUCTeX command.
